Israel uses many tactics to control and displace Palestinian communities. Fom turning a blind eye to settler violence, to withholding building and infrastructure permits and preventing access to drinking water, to declaring land as a militarised “firing zone'' and therefore erasing entire villages - we have seen them all. One of the areas designated for clearance is Masafer Yatta, comprising of eight villages in the South Hebron Hills, with a population of 1300 Palestinian reidents. The case against the demolition was heard on Tuesday in the Israeli High Court of Justice, and following an adjournment, a new date for the hearing will be set.
Combatants for Peace members gathered outside the High Court with around 150 Palestinian and Israeli residents and activists to show our collective support for the people of Masafer Yatta, and let them know that we stand with them, and will defend their right to stay in their homes and on their land.
